Des Moines, Iowa – Tornadoes are often associated with the Great Plains, and Iowa sits near the center of one of the most active severe weather corridors in the United States, giving residents only minutes to act when an alert is issued.
According to the National Weather Service, tornadoes occur most frequently between the Rocky Mountains and west of the Appalachians, placing Iowa squarely in a high-risk zone. The state averages dozens of confirmed tornadoes in many years, with peak activity in late spring and early summer when warm, humid air collides with powerful cold fronts across the Midwest…
